Coolant Pump for CruisAir A/C - 500gph

Hi -
I need to replace the pump on my cruisair AC unit. It is a 500GPH Taylor Made pump. I think I can use any 500 GPH unit. ANyone rebuild these? (the Taylor is runninng it just runs in spurts and doesn't have enough juice to push through the unit). I flushed the unit with fresh water -- so that doesn't seem to be the problem.
